Rick Ross was released from his Reebok shoe campaign over his “U.O.E.N.O” lyrics. To add more to the story, sources tell TMZ that Ross is expected to lose a large amount from his Reebok deal.

TMZ reports Ross will lose between $3.5 million to $5 million. Even after Ross issued an official apology, Reebok felt he didn’t accurately represent the brand’s mission statement.

Ross is allegedly telling people close to him that he is entitled to forgiveness because he helped popularized Reebok in hip-hop. However, they believed Ross didn’t display the same amount of concern about the situation, and is looking to move forward.
